Germany
Holiday
Inn Express Munich Airport-Erding (in development): The 118-guest room
hotel signed with HR Group is due to open in late 2024. The hotel is
pet-friendly and features conference space, and a bar that stocks from a
neighbourhood brewery.
Kimpton
Frankfurt Main (in development): The first Kimpton-branded hotel in
Germany is set to open in late 2024 as part of the FOUR development shaping
Frankfurt’s new skyline. Signed with Gross & Partner, the property features
155 guest rooms, meeting and event space, a gym, two restaurants and two bars.
Holiday
Inn – the niu (open and in development): This brand collaboration between
IHG’s Holiday Inn brand and NOVUM Hospitality’s the niu brand has already
achieved 30** openings in the 162** days since the
signing of a long-term agreement in April 2024. This brand
collaboration opened most recently in Hamburg and can also be found in cities
including Berlin, Düsseldorf, Frankfurt, Stuttgart and Bremen**. Two more**
Holiday Inn – the niu properties have now been signed in addition to the
initial 52 agreed.
Garner
(in development): 56 Garner hotels were signed in April 2024 as part of a
long-term agreement between IHG and NOVUM Hospitality. These hotels will be
converted to IHG’s newest midscale conversion brand from NOVUM Hospitality’s
Yggotel, Select Hotels and Novum hotel brands. The first Garner hotels are
slated to open in Germany from late 2024.
Candlewood
Suites (in development): 11 Candlewood Suites properties were also signed
in April 2024 as part of IHG’s long-term agreement with NOVUM Hospitality.
These hotels will convert from NOVUM’s acora Living the City brand,
and are due to begin opening from early 2025.
Poland
Holiday
Inn Express Lublin (in development): Set to open towards the end of 2024,
this hotel marks IHG’s fourth Holiday Inn Express hotel in Poland, and its
first in Lublin. Signed with one of the largest Polish owners and operators,
Polski Holding Hotelowy, as a conversion from an independent hotel, the
property offers 150 guest rooms, a restaurant and meeting facilities, and is
located in the city centre close to Lublin’s Old Town.
voco
Katowice (in development): This 167-guest room hotel marks the voco hotels
brand’s entry into Poland, having also been signed with Polski Holding Hotelowy
as a conversion from an independent property. Planned to open in 2025, voco
Katowice will be located in the heart of the city, close to the International
Congress Centre, and the concert hall of the Polish National Radio Symphony
Orchestra.
Hotel
Indigo Krakow – Wawel Castle (in development): This property is IHG’s
second Hotel Indigo in Krakow and is set to open in 2025. Signed with local
premium real estate developer, Howell Estates, the hotel features 74 guest
rooms, a restaurant, bar and wellness area. Guests will also enjoy being few
steps away from Krakow Old Town, Wawel Royal Castle and Kazimierz Jewish
District.
Hungary
Kimpton
BEM Budapest (now open): Opened in July 2024, Kimpton
BEM Budapest’s interior honour Hungarian folklore while celebrating the
city’s modern vitality. The hotel was developed with owning company MAM Buda
Project Kft. and features 127 guest rooms and three innovative restaurants. The
transformation of this 19th-century Grade-two historical building has been
meticulously created by the renowned Marcel Wanders.
Verno
House Budapest, Vignette Collection (now open): This new opening is the
perfect one-of-a-kind boutique retreat for travellers wanting to escape the
hustle and bustle of the city opened as part of IHG’s Vignette Collection in
August Owned and operated by BDPST Group, the property features 48 stylish
guest rooms, a Michelin Guide-recommended restaurant and a dedicated
BOTANIQ Collection Wellness Department.
voco
Szekesfehervar (in development): This hotel has been signed as the first
IHG property outside of the Hungarian capital Budapest, and as the first voco
hotels property in the country. The hotel is owned by CBA-Újhegy and operated
by Hotel & More Group. Featuring 95 guest rooms, a bar, restaurant, gym and
meeting space, it’s planned to open in 2025.
Sweden
voco
Stockholm - Kista (now open): Having opened
in early September 2024, this hotel marks IHG’s re-entry into Sweden
With 201 guest rooms and located in the heart of Stockholm's Silicon Valley,
the brand new, full-service hotel is an exciting addition to the city scape
welcoming business and leisure guests from around the world. The property was
developed by Revelop and is operated by Mogotel.
Belgium
Holiday
Inn Express Brussels - Airport (now open): This recently opened hotel was
signed and developed with Borealis Hotel Group, featuring 208 guest rooms. A
short journey from the heart of Brussels and next to the city’s airport, it
also is conveniently located for NATO Headquarters and other major businesses.
IHG
has 197 open hotels and 169 properties under development across its Northern
Europe market, which comprises 13 countries. Brands currently available to
book** include Six Senses, Regent, InterContinental, Vignette Collection,
Kimpton, Hotel Indigo, voco hotels, Crowne Plaza, Holiday Inn, Holiday Inn
Express and Staybridge Suites.
